Folkestone has retained much of its old world charm.

Folkestone has retained much of its old world charm. It is a very old town with a lot of interesting history, from smuggling to being a main port for departure and arrival from France for many years. It is surrounded by gently rolling hills and is only about a 45 minute drive to Canterbury. Folkestone's main shopping street has many small shops as well as a Sainsbury, Asda and Lidl store all close by. The old high street is very picturesque with a steep slope and a cobbled road. Folkestone harbour is a good place to visit and there is both a sandy beach and shingle beaches.

Folkestone is just up and coming enough that it is still...

Folkestone is just up and coming enough that it is still funky, but also general feels safe. The arts quarter and harbour are particularly worth a visit with excellent art galleries, great bakeries and interesting options for street food or fairly priced restaurant food. Mermaid beach and The Leas are especially beautiful, but there are a lot of steep slopes and steps, so you need to be reasonably fit.
